Signs the Crawl Space Is Holding Water

Recognizing early signs of water in the crawl space can prevent more serious damage. Musty or earthy odors often signal trapped moisture. Insulation may sag, feel damp, or show discoloration if it has absorbed water. Condensation on pipes or wooden framing is another sign of high humidity below the home.

Damp or soft subflooring above the crawl space may indicate water has moved up through the structure. Pests such as insects or rodents often appear when moisture attracts them to the area. In some cases, standing water, mud, or visible pooling may be seen—even if hidden under insulation or debris. Any of these clues should prompt a closer inspection.

Common Sources of Crawl Space Moisture

Crawl space moisture can come from several sources. Poor exterior grading is a frequent contributor: if the ground slopes toward the house, rainwater may pool at the foundation and seep inside. Faulty or clogged gutters and downspouts can also direct water toward the crawl space instead of away from it.

Groundwater may rise and enter if the soil around the house stays saturated for long periods. Plumbing leaks inside the crawl space, such as from supply pipes or drains, introduce water directly into the area. Humid outside air can enter through vents or gaps, leading to condensation when it contacts cooler surfaces. Bare-earth floors in crawl spaces retain moisture and can release it into the air, prolonging dampness.

How Moisture Moves from Crawl Spaces into Your Home

Moisture issues in a crawl space rarely stay contained. Damp air can move upward through gaps in the subfloor, floor vents, or framing cracks, raising the humidity inside living spaces. Over time, this increased moisture can affect flooring, cause wood to swell or warp, and contribute to the slow deterioration of structural materials.

Crawl spaces often dry slowly due to limited ventilation, high humidity, and bare-earth floors that continuously release moisture. The EPA recommends that wet materials be dried within 24 to 48 hours to reduce the conditions that allow mold to grow. Persistent dampness in the crawl space makes meeting this timeline difficult without professional drying and moisture control.

When Not to Enter a Crawl Space

Some crawl space conditions make entry unsafe for homeowners. Standing water may be contaminated—especially if it includes gray water from plumbing leaks or black water from sewage or outside flooding. Contact with contaminated water can be hazardous and should be handled by trained professionals equipped for safe sanitation.

If you see signs of structural instability, such as sagging supports or rotted wood, avoid entering. Large areas of visible mold (more than about 10 square feet) also call for professional assessment, as recommended by EPA guidance. Restoration professionals use personal protective equipment and specialized tools to safely inspect and address crawl space water issues.

How Professionals Locate, Remove, and Prevent Crawl Space Moisture

Independent restoration professionals use specialized tools to assess crawl space water damage. Moisture meters, thermal imaging cameras, and hygrometers help pinpoint both visible and hidden moisture. Pros inspect plumbing, subflooring, and foundation walls to find the source and extent of water intrusion.

Once the affected areas are identified, pros remove standing water using pumps and extractors. Category 2 (gray) or Category 3 (black) water requires careful handling and sanitation protocols. After water removal, air movers and dehumidifiers dry out wood, insulation, and subfloors. Fast drying reduces the conditions that allow mold to grow, and professionals monitor moisture levels until materials reach appropriate dryness.

When water damage is extensive, some materials may need to be removed and replaced. Whether a material is salvageable depends on the water source, how long it has been wet, visible damage, and manufacturer recommendations. Reconstruction costs and approaches vary based on these factors.

Prevention focuses on improving drainage, repairing plumbing leaks, installing vapor barriers over bare-earth floors, and managing humidity with ventilation or dehumidifiers. Regular inspections help catch new issues before they become severe.

How soon should a wet crawl space be dried to reduce mold risk?
EPA guidance recommends that wet materials be dried within 24 to 48 hours to reduce the conditions that allow mold to grow. Fast, thorough drying is important after water intrusion.
Will homeowners insurance cover crawl space water damage?
Coverage depends on the cause and your specific policy. Sudden and accidental water damage may be covered, while flood damage from rising water generally requires separate flood insurance.
Why does crawl space moisture linger longer than in other parts of a home?
Crawl spaces often have high humidity, low airflow, and may include bare-earth floors that hold moisture. These conditions make evaporation and drying much slower compared to more open, ventilated spaces.
